Output f43e256cc3c23c2930ec58808b8afebaa67eabd6b9161c207d6ba180ccf90dc5:0

value
629652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5324014682a1bda2b10bdb184cae8d79ab931852 OP_EQUALVERIFY OP_CHECKSIG
address
18acDbLHyZjtzV5HdSoZMXE8pB8KUStZeT
transaction
f43e256cc3c23c2930ec58808b8afebaa67eabd6b9161c207d6ba180ccf90dc5
spent
true